Requires the department of natural resources to study and issue a report on the following topics: (1) opportunities to leverage public land to improve public health outcomes; (2) options for a consistent visitor fee collection system at state fish and wildlife areas; and (3) a plan to mitigate and recover from natural disasters affecting public land.
